Why did Jesus have to leave Nazareth?

This part is unclear to me: What made Jesus decide that he had to leave the village of his youth? Do you suppose he felt a calling, or did he leave for different reasons?

Luke 2:41-52 tells the story of Jesus who stayed behind in Jerusalem after Passover. When his parents fetched him, he told them that he needed to stay to do the work of his Father. This passage clarifies the matter. He left Nazareth because he had a calling.
